Transaction c709e41898f26073f14e90d91d3a48d4840511046522610b61bc0dac82ca15de
1 Input
2 Outputs
- c709e41898f26073f14e90d91d3a48d4840511046522610b61bc0dac82ca15de:0
- c709e41898f26073f14e90d91d3a48d4840511046522610b61bc0dac82ca15de:1
value 89950000
address 3LcpryKngKt5Pw1mBnsSicGn42n4ZF1EmU
value 300486874
address 16M7MUtgcTMivkQ8zhC2YbHHDw6wgewEtX